HISTAFED vs TRINALIN
Comparing the clinical profiles, pharmacokinetic behaviors, and safety indices of these two therapeutic agents.
HISTAFED is a combination of pseudoephedrine, a sympathomimetic amine that acts as a decongestant by stimulating alpha-adrenergic receptors in the nasal mucosa causing vasoconstriction, and triprolidine, a first-generation antihistamine that competes with histamine for H1-receptor sites on effector cells in the gastrointestinal tract, blood vessels, and respiratory tract, thereby preventing histamine-mediated effects.
TRINALIN is a combination of azatadine, a first-generation antihistamine that antagonizes histamine H1 receptors, and pseudoephedrine, a sympathomimetic amine that stimulates alpha-adrenergic receptors, causing vasoconstriction and reducing nasal congestion.
